Skip to content

wip: lazy tab restore for faster startup#455

Closed
toberyan wants to merge 1 commit intolinuxdeepin:masterfrom
toberyan:master
Closed

wip: lazy tab restore for faster startup#455
toberyan wants to merge 1 commit intolinuxdeepin:masterfrom
toberyan:master

Conversation

@toberyan
Copy link
Copy Markdown

Refactor tab recovery to only immediately load the focused tab on startup; non-focused tabs remain in a pending state and are loaded on demand when the user switches to them. This avoids blocking the UI with N file loads during session restore.

Refactor tab recovery to only immediately load the focused tab on
startup; non-focused tabs remain in a pending state and are loaded
on demand when the user switches to them. This avoids blocking the UI
with N file loads during session restore.
Copy link
Copy Markdown

@sourcery-ai sourcery-ai Bot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Sorry @toberyan, you have reached your weekly rate limit of 500000 diff characters.

Please try again later or upgrade to continue using Sourcery

@deepin-ci-robot
Copy link
Copy Markdown

[APPROVALNOTIFIER] This PR is NOT APPROVED

This pull-request has been approved by: toberyan

The full list of commands accepted by this bot can be found here.

Details Needs approval from an approver in each of these files:

Approvers can indicate their approval by writing /approve in a comment
Approvers can cancel approval by writing /approve cancel in a comment

@toberyan toberyan closed this Apr 29,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ants